How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Rock Spring?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Rock Spring Studio Apartments | $886 | $795 | $1,069 |
Rock Spring 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,053 | $720 | $2,237 |
Rock Spring 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,416 | $900 | $2,827 |
Rock Spring 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,853 | $1,031 | $5,533 |
Rock Spring 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,608 | $1,344 | $5,251 |
